As the CAT exam 2025 is around the corner, let us quickly take a look at several crucial CAT exam details. Here it goes:
CAT Exam 2025 Parameters | CAT 2025 Exam Details |
---|---|
CAT Full Form | Common Aptitude Test |
Conducting Body | Indian Institutes of Management (IIMs) |
CAT 2025 Registration Start Date | August 1, 2025 |
CAT 2025 Registration Last Date | September 13, 2025 |
CAT 2025 Admit Card Download Date | November 5, 2025 – November 30, 2025 |
CAT 2025 Exam Date | November 30, 2025 |
CAT Result | Second Week of January 2026 (Tentative) |
CAT 2025 Exam Fees | INR 2,600 (General Category) INR 1,300 (SC/ST/PwD) |
CAT Official Website | iimcat.ac.in |
Here is a detailed overview of things to carry for CAT exam 2025. Explore what documents to carry for CAT 2025 and other items:
The CAT admit card is the first and foremost crucial document to carry to the exam hall. This is the entry ticket to the exam hall that you must not forget or lose. While the CAT admit cards become available on the official website of IIM CAT, it is mandatory to get the admit card printed for a hard copy. Furthermore, make sure that your admit card contains all the crucial details such as your name, registration number, application number, exam centre name and address, date, timings, and PwD status (if applicable). It must also have your photograph printed, which you have taken during the application process.
Pro Tip: Do not sign or write anything on the admit card. In such a case, your entry to the exam hall would be restricted.
Along with an admit card, having a government-issued ID proof is crucial. You would be required to showcase your proof for being a residential citizen of India or a foreign candidate. The list of ID proofs is generally included in the CAT guidelines. You may take a look here to learn about the valid government ID proofs list:
You would also need two up-to-date and neat photographs during the exam. Make sure that your photograph matches the one uploaded during the time of registration. Photographs must not contain any stamp or signature over them. It is one of the mandatory things to carry for the CAT exam.
Carrying the medical certificate is crucial for those suffering from any medical issues. In case of any emergency, this certification would be required for further processing. Apart from this, individuals belonging to the PwD category must also carry a medical certificate along with a scribe affidavit that supports the PwD claim. Moreover, candidates must make sure that the medical certificate is provided by a certified MBBS doctor.
If you have modified or changed your name recently, you must carry the documents related to the name change. It is one of the crucial things to carry for CAT exam for those who have changed their name. These documents would be required at the time of the name verification process, so that there shall be no mismatches or problems during the procedure.
You may need a COVID self-declaration document to enter the exam hall. However, it is not mandatory unless it is mentioned on your admit card or the official website of the CAT exam, during the time of registration or in the guidelines.
There are several things that you must not carry to the CAT exam centre. The items included in this list are forbidden by the IIM CAT exam centres to maintain security and fairness during the exam. Carrying any of these objects to the CAT exam centre may result in the cancellation or disqualification of the exam. Let us quickly take a look at the things not to carry for CAT exam:
Item Categories | Things NOT to Carry for CAT 2025 |
---|---|
Electronics |
Mobile Phones Calculators Smartwatches Bluetooth Devices Fitness Bands Tablets |
Accessories |
Wallets Caps/Hats Sunglasses Backpacks Handbags Purses/Clutches |
Stationery |
Pens & Pencils Geometry Boxes Erasers Rulers Papers (All required stationery is provided by the exam centre) |
Footwear |
Shoes / Sports Shoes Boots (Only Slippers & Sandals are allowed) |
Learning Materials |
Notes Cheat Sheets Printed Materials Books Rough Papers |
Metal Wearables |
Bangles Chains/Necklaces Rings Belts with metal buckles Earrings Nose pins Hair pins & accessories |
Food & Beverages |
Chocolates Water Bottles (carry transparent ones if allowed by exam centre) Snacks Chewing Gum |
The CAT exam 2025 follows a rigorous dress code policy. It ensures the transparency and fairness of the exam, avoiding post-exam chaos. If you reach the exam hall in the wrong or restricted attire, it could lead to exam delay, cancellation, or even disqualification in extreme cases. Therefore, it is vital for everyone to understand the dress code of the exam thoroughly and prepare their CAT dress code at least a week before the exam. Here are the general guidelines for the CAT exam dress code 2025. Let us explore:
CAT Dress Code for Males | CAT Dress Code for Females |
---|---|
Plain Shirt or Half-Sleeve Shirts/T-Shirts | Plain Tops / Salwar |
No accessories, including belts, watches, etc. | T-Shirts with Leggings |
Trousers / Track Pants (without pockets) | Jeans, Denims, or Trousers with no pockets |
Slippers or Open Sandals | Slippers / Open Sandals |
CAT Dress Code for Males (Not Allowed) | CAT Dress Code for Females (Not Allowed) |
---|---|
Denims with pockets / Cargo Pants | Tops and Kurtis with frills and pockets |
Full-Sleeve Shirts / T-Shirts / Hoodies | Bottoms with layers and pockets |
Shoes / Sports Shoes / Boots | Earrings / Clips / Bangles / Hair Accessories |
Smartwatches / Bracelets / Belts | High heels / Shoes / Boots |

You need to carry a CAT admit card, any one of the valid ID proofs issued by the government of India, such as Aadhar card, PAN card, voter ID, passport, etc., and two neat and clean photographs that match the photo uploaded during the time of registration. Additionally, candidates with medical emergencies and PwD candidates require a medical certificate. PwD candidates may also need to show a scribe affidavit. Name change documents are required for those who have recently changed or modified their names.
The photograph size must be under 80 kilobytes. Moreover, only the photographs with 1200 x 1200 dimensions may be uploaded in the CAT exam form. The format of the CAT photograph must be .jpg or .jpeg.
No, mehndi is not allowed in the CAT exam centres as it hinders the process of fingerprint scanning or biometrics. Applying mehndi on your hands during the CAT exam can also lead to disqualification if you cannot verify over biometrics.
No, you cannot wear a hoodie to the CAT exam hall, as hoodies are strictly forbidden in the CAT exam. Any attire that includes layering, hoods, or caps is prohibited for the CAT exam.
